'状态栏添加按钮
<CommandMethod("AddButton")> _
Public Sub AddButton()
Dim Button As Pane = New Pane
Button.Enabled = True
Button.Text = "添加按钮实例"
Button.ToolTipText = "添加按钮实例 ToolTipsText"
Button.Visible = True
Button.Style = PaneStyles.Normal
AddHandler Button.MouseDown, AddressOf StatusBarButton1_MouseDown
Application.StatusBar.Panes.Add(Button)
End Sub
Sub StatusBarButton1_MouseDown(ByVal sender As Object, ByVal e As StatusBarMouseDownEventArgs)
Dim Button As Pane = sender
MsgBox("你按下了该按钮,你可在此添加你要执行的代码!")
End Sub
<CommandMethod("AddButton")> _
Public Sub AddButton()
Dim Button As Pane = New Pane
Button.Enabled = True
Button.Text = "添加按钮实例"
Button.ToolTipText = "添加按钮实例 ToolTipsText"
Button.Visible = True
Button.Style = PaneStyles.Normal
AddHandler Button.MouseDown, AddressOf StatusBarButton1_MouseDown
Application.StatusBar.Panes.Add(Button)
End Sub
Sub StatusBarButton1_MouseDown(ByVal sender As Object, ByVal e As StatusBarMouseDownEventArgs)
Dim Button As Pane = sender
MsgBox("你按下了该按钮,你可在此添加你要执行的代码!")
End Sub
Autodesk.AutoCAD.ApplicationServices.Application.StatusBar.Panes.Add
和Autodesk.AutoCAD.ApplicationServices.Application.DocumentManager.MdiActiveDocument.StatusBar.Panes.Add添加的效果是一样的。
[本日志由 tiancao1001 于 2009-12-30 05:30 PM 编辑]
|
|
暂时没有评论
| 发表评论 - 不要忘了输入验证码哦! |
用户登陆
站点日历
站点统计
最新评论
AutoCAD .Net为状态栏添加按钮(VB.Net) [ 日期:2009-12-30 ] [ 来自: